Strategic descent from top to bottom via plinko delivers unpredictable rewards and engaging gameplay

The allure of games of chance has captivated audiences for centuries, and few embody this fascination quite like plinko. This deceptively simple game, often seen as a staple of game shows, involves dropping a puck from the top of a board filled with pegs. As the puck descends, it bounces randomly off the pegs, changing direction with each impact. The ultimate goal is to navigate the puck into one of the prize slots at the bottom, with varying values assigned to each slot. The inherent unpredictability of the descent is what makes plinko so appealing, offering a thrilling experience where skill has limited influence and luck reigns supreme.

The beauty of plinko lies in its accessibility and the visually engaging nature of the gameplay. Its mechanics are easy to understand, making it enjoyable for players of all ages and backgrounds. While often associated with high-energy game show formats, its fundamental principles can be found in various forms of entertainment and even scientific simulations. The cascading pattern of the puck creates a mesmerizing spectacle, and the anticipation of where it will land keeps players on the edge of their seats. Beyond mere entertainment, variations of the plinko game are increasingly being used as examples to illustrate concepts of probability and random distribution in educational contexts.

Understanding the Physics of the Descent

The seemingly random nature of a plinko board’s outcome isn't entirely chaotic. The trajectory of the puck is governed by a combination of factors, primarily the initial drop point and the arrangement of the pegs. Each peg acts as an obstacle, redirecting the puck either to the left or right. The distribution of these pegs across the board, and their precise placement, significantly impacts the probabilities of landing in different prize slots. Though predicting the exact path is impossible, understanding the basic principles of physics can offer insights into the likely outcomes. The angle of incidence, the coefficient of restitution (how much energy is preserved in the bounce), and the peg’s geometry all contribute to the puck’s shifting course.

The Evolution of Plinko: From Game Shows to Virtual Realms

The popularity of plinko initially exploded through its inclusion in iconic game shows, most notably The Price Is Right. This exposure transformed the game from a relatively obscure novelty into a household name. The dramatic tension of watching the puck descend, combined with the potential for significant winnings, created compelling television. Over time, plinko has transcended its television origins, finding new life in the digital world. Numerous online and mobile versions of the game have been developed, offering players the opportunity to experience the thrill of plinko anytime, anywhere.

Plinko as a Model for Random Systems

Beyond entertainment, the mechanics of plinko serve as a compelling model for understanding how random systems function. Scientists and engineers use similar principles to analyze phenomena ranging from particle diffusion to stock market fluctuations. The plinko board effectively demonstrates the impact of multiple random events on an overall outcome. By studying the puck’s descent, researchers can gain insights into the distribution of probabilities and the emergence of patterns in seemingly chaotic systems. This illustrates the surprising relevance of a simple game to complex scientific inquiries and developmental models. It demonstrates the underlying mathematical principles that govern randomness and chance events, offering a visual representation for educational purposes.

The study of plinko’s behavior can be applied to simulations of logistical systems, resource allocation, and even the spread of information networks. It highlights the importance of considering the cumulative effect of small, random perturbations on larger-scale outcomes. Further investigation of the game’s dynamics may reveal novel approaches to optimizing decision-making in environments characterized by inherent uncertainty. Ultimately, plinko offers a tangible and engaging way to explore the fundamental principles of probability and randomness.
